What Is A Silk Pillowcase?

A silk pillowcase is exactly what it sounds like – a pillowcase made from silk. It’s typically made from high-quality, 100% pure mulberry silk, which is hypoallergenic and gentle on both hair and skin.

Why Should You Use A Silk Pillowcase?

There are many benefits to using a silk pillowcase, including:

  • Reduced friction on hair, which can prevent breakage, split ends, and frizz
  • Gentler on skin, reducing the risk of wrinkles and creases
  • Naturally hypoallergenic, making it a great choice for those with sensitive skin
  • Helps regulate body temperature, keeping you cool in the summer and warm in the winter

Pros And Cons Of Using A Silk Pillowcase

As with anything, there are pros and cons to using a silk pillowcase. Here are a few to consider:

Pros:

  • Gentle on hair and skin
  • Hypoallergenic
  • Temperature-regulating
  • Can reduce the risk of wrinkles and breakouts

Cons:

  • Can be more expensive than traditional cotton pillowcases
  • May require special washing instructions
  • May not be as durable as other materials

Q&A And FAQs

Q: Can silk pillowcases help with acne?

A: Yes, silk pillowcases can help reduce the risk of acne by reducing the amount of bacteria and oil that can accumulate on your skin while you sleep.

Q: How often should I wash my silk pillowcase?

A: It’s recommended to wash your silk pillowcase at least once a week to keep it clean and fresh. Be sure to follow the washing instructions carefully to avoid damaging the material.

Q: Can I use a silk pillowcase if I have curly hair?

A: Yes, silk pillowcases are great for all hair types, including curly hair. They can help reduce frizz and breakage, resulting in smoother, healthier-looking curls.
